Picking the Perfect Plastic Shredder for Your Demands

Establishing the appropriate plastic shredder for your operation involves careful evaluation of several aspects. Firstly, consider the kinds of resin you'll be handling – HDPE, plastic #1, and low-density polyethylene all possess different treatment abilities. Moreover, evaluate the volume of scrap you discard frequently; a small workshop may benefit from a entry-level unit, while a large waste management location will require a heavy-duty system. Lastly, factor in your financial resources and the accessible room for location.

The Evolution of Plastic Film Washing Technology

The technique of washing film treatment systems has experienced a dramatic evolution over the decades . Initially, simple manual methods were employed , often relying on brushes and water alone. As need for higher purity escalated , more systems were created. The arrival of aqueous compounds for removing adhered contaminants marked a important milestone . Today, state-of-the-art polymer cleaning operations utilize intricate mixtures of scrubbing, chemical, and separation approaches to attain maximum performance for repurposing and further applications .
